Crystal structure of the human MBL-associated protein 19 (MAp19)
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ESRF BEAMLINE BM14 |
| Synchrotron site | ESRF |
| Beamline | BM14 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2001-06-21 |
| Detector | MARRESEARCH |
| Wavelength(s) | 0.946 |
| Spacegroup name | P 43 21 2 |
| Unit cell lengths | 67.754, 67.754, 187.923 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 17.000 - 2.500 |
| R-factor | 0.263 |
| Rwork | 0.261 |
| R-free | 0.31600 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 1nt0 |
| Data reduction software | XDS |
| Data scaling software | XDS |
| Phasing software | AMoRE |
| Refinement software | CNS |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 17.000 | 2.600 |
| High resolution limit [Å] | 2.500 | 2.500 |
| Number of reflections | 15712 | |
| <I/σ(I)> | 23.7 | 5.1 |
| Completeness [%] | 94.8 | 86.1 |
| Redundancy | 3.5 | 2.2 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 8.5 | 293 | PEG8000, pH 8.5,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
